  • July 25 - Safety on the Rails
    2025/07/25

    On this day in Labor History the year was 1832. That was the day of the first recorded railroad accident in U.S. history. It took place near Quincy, Massachusetts. Four people were thrown off a vacant car on the Granite Railway.

  • July 24 - America’s First General Strike
    2025/07/24

    On this day in Labor History the year was 1877. Workers organized the first general strike in American history. The strike was an outgrowth of the railroad strike which you may know, if you are a regular listener of Labor History in 2:00, that started ten days earlier in Martinsburg, West Virginia.

  • July 23 - Remembering Alexander Berkman
    2025/07/23

    On this day in Labor History the year was 1892. That was the day that Lithuanian-born anarchist, Alexander Berkman attempted to shoot steel magnate Andrew Carnegie’s second-in-command, Henry Clay Frick. Berkman wanted to avenge the Homestead Steel massacre in which nine workers were killed.
